Engineered by Cesaroni Technology, the 9876M1890-P is a 98mm solid rocket motor designed for extreme high-power rocketry. As an official M-class motor, it delivers a total impulse of 9875.6 Ns over a 5.25 second burn window.

With an average thrust of 1889.0 N and a peak of 2401.6 N, it features a dual-peak thrust curve optimal for sustainer stages and high-altitude attempts. It utilizes the Red Lightning propellant formulation, dictating its specific impulse and exhaust signature.
